What Indian Tribe Did The Pilgrims Meet At Plymouth?

The Wampanoag have lived in southeastern Massachusetts for more than 12,000 years. They are the tribe first encountered by Mayflower Pilgrims when they landed in Provincetown harbor and explored the eastern coast of Cape Cod and when they continued on to Wampanoag (Plymouth) to establish Plymouth Colony.
